Ernest Dominic Capersis an American football coach who is the defensive coordinator for the Green Bay Packers of the National Football League. Capers served as the head coach for the NFL's Carolina Panthers from 1995 and 1998 and for the Houston Texans from 2002 to 2005. He is the only person to serve two different NFL expansion teams as their inaugural head coach...
